Sam Cassell Explains Why He Joined Celtics As Assistant Coach

Is Joe Mazzulla head coach material? I think most Celtics fans think the answer to that question is no. Maybe he doesn’t have to be. Sam Cassell signed on with Boston to become a lead assistant coach. The hope is that Cassell proves to be a vital addition behind the bench.

However, what made Cassell choose Boston as his next landing spot? Cassell spent last season with Doc Rivers but once Doc got canned, Cassell had his pick of the litter once Nick Nurse got the job in Philly. The 15-year NBA vet explained why he picked the Celtics as his next coaching destination.

“Joe made this happen,” Cassell told Heavy Sports in a story published Sunday. “He’s watched me work a couple of guys out before and wanted to understand my personality and how I link to players. We have some mutual friends that he contacted, and we just made it work.”

Way to go, Joe! It’s hard to hate on the hire. Cassell was always a grinder and should bring back some of the toughness that left when Udoka got canned. Cassell also won a ring as a player during his stint with the Celtics. That’s not including the two rings he won with Houston. The guy is a winner and knows what it’s like to be through the grind.

“I’m a great listener to players; I’m a former player, so I understand what they’re going through,” Cassell told Heavy Sports. “Like I tell them all the time, I’ve been each player on a team, from the top guy to the 15th player. I’ve been all those guys. I understand what those guys are going through mentally.”

The Celtics 2022-23 team felt screwed from the get-go when Ime Udoka got suspended by the team. Keep in mind that was on the heels of Will Hardy taking the Utah job and Damon Stoudamire leaving for Georgia Tech. The Celtics weren’t just going with 4th-string coach Joe Mazzulla. They also had zero staff behind him. If Boston fans are looking for reasons to be optimistic, the beefed up staff is one of them.
